Specialty Care is the largest provider of perfusion services in the United States, and we are continuing to grow! With our national presence and local professionals, we participate in more than 100,000 surgeries each year in 45 states, the District of Columbia and Puerto Rico – that equates to 1 in 8 of all heart surgeries in the country. We serve more than 350 hospitals and support nearly 600 surgeons and are the Employer of Choice for more than 500 perfusion leaders.

Position Requirements
  • Graduate of Accredited Perfusion training program, minimum required.
  • Certification by the American Board of Cardiovascular Perfusion (ABCP).
  • Five plus years of perfusion experience; previous experience as a Chief Perfusionist preferred.
  • Ability to work on Call; must live within 30 minutes from the hospital.
